GMO is a Boston-based investment manager co-founded by Jeremy Grantham and known for our thoughtful, candid research and valuation driven, high conviction investing. For 45 years, GMO has primarily served traditional institutions such as endowments, foundations, family offices, and large pension funds. We are thrilled to let you know, GMO is now available on the UBS platforms via one of our more unique and timely investment strategies, the GMO Opportunistic Income Fund GMOLX (GMODX oldest share class). An Inefficient Market With a Wide Set of Opportunities The GMO Opportunistic Income Fund seeks capital appreciation and current income by investing in what we believe are the most attractively priced sectors and securities in the structured finance marketplace. We believe that the marketplace’s complexity, periods of challenging past performance, and very high number of discrete investment opportunities create considerable potential for alpha generation. GMO approaches the market without what we feel are uneconomic constraints or mandates, such as asset class, credit rating, duration, or yield targets. The result is a fairly unconstrained, absolute return, multisector securitized approach, striking the right balance of risk-adjusted returns and managing downside volatility. Why GMO and Why Now?
